- The distance between Charshangngy, Turkmenistan and Potsdam, Germany is approximately 4,368 km or 2,714 mi.
- To reach Charshangngy in this distance one would set out from Potsdam bearing 90.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Charshangngy bearing 129.7° or SE .
- Charshangngy has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Potsdam has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Charshangngy is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ome whereas Potsdam is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 9.4 °C (17°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.3 °C (16.7°F) more in Charshangngy.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 421.7 mm (16.6 in) less which is equivalent to 421.7 l/m² (10.35 US gal/ft²) or 4,217,000 l/ha (450,825 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.9° higher in Charshangngy than in Potsdam.
